Blk 553 Serangoon Nth Ave 3 is an HDB block in Serangoon (completed in 1995, 9 storeys, 56 units). As of Jul 2026, its median resale price over the last 24 months is $623,000, about 20% below the Serangoon median, from 1 sales. 65 resale transactions have been recorded here since 1990.

On price per square metre, this block is cheaper than 84% of Serangoon blocks with recent sales.
For a typical 4-room flat here, our price model estimates $564,554–$631,535 (central estimate $598,044). Recent sales — median $511,755 — sit below that range. The model explains 94% of resale prices with a typical error of ±6%. Indicative only — not an official valuation.
